MSSQL/SSMSで実行したクエリー結果をコピー時改行も保持する方法
の編集
Top
/
MSSQL
/
SSMSで実行したクエリー結果をコピー時改行も保持する方法
[
トップ
] [
編集
|
差分
|
バックアップ
|
添付
|
リロード
] [
新規
|
一覧
|
検索
|
最終更新
|
ヘルプ
]
-- 雛形とするページ --
PostgreSQL/template0とtemplate1の違いについて
#navi(../) * SQL Server Management Studio (SSMS)のクエリー結果のコピー時に改行を保持する方法 [#vee5056b] SSMSでクエリーを実行して、VARCHARなどの改行が入ったカラムをコピーし他のアプリケーションなどに貼り付けると改行が無く、1行で貼り付けられてしまいます。(デフォルトでは) 以下の操作設定により、改行を含めてコピーすることができ、他のアプリケーションに改行付きで貼り付けることができます。 #contents * 動作確認環境 - Windows 10 ver.22H2 - SQL Server~ Microsoft SQL Server 2019 - SQL Server Management Studio (SSMS)~ v18.12.1 * コピーまたは保存時にCR/LFを保持 させる設定 [#hbb538c8] SSMSを起動し、以下の設定操作をすることによりコピー時にCR/LFを保持することができます。 + ツール -> オプション をクリックします。 #br #ref(01.png) #br + オプション画面が表示されるので、下記キャプチャのように操作し、「コピーまたは保存時にCR/LFを保持にチェックを入れOKボタンを押します。~ クエリ結果 -> SQL Server -> 結果をグリッドに表示 #br #ref(02.png) #br 尚、設定しても改行保持でコピーできなかった場合は、SSMSを再起動してください。 以上の操作により、クエリー結果をコピーしても改行が保持されてクリップボードに保存されます。~
タイムスタンプを変更しない
#navi(../) * SQL Server Management Studio (SSMS)のクエリー結果のコピー時に改行を保持する方法 [#vee5056b] SSMSでクエリーを実行して、VARCHARなどの改行が入ったカラムをコピーし他のアプリケーションなどに貼り付けると改行が無く、1行で貼り付けられてしまいます。(デフォルトでは) 以下の操作設定により、改行を含めてコピーすることができ、他のアプリケーションに改行付きで貼り付けることができます。 #contents * 動作確認環境 - Windows 10 ver.22H2 - SQL Server~ Microsoft SQL Server 2019 - SQL Server Management Studio (SSMS)~ v18.12.1 * コピーまたは保存時にCR/LFを保持 させる設定 [#hbb538c8] SSMSを起動し、以下の設定操作をすることによりコピー時にCR/LFを保持することができます。 + ツール -> オプション をクリックします。 #br #ref(01.png) #br + オプション画面が表示されるので、下記キャプチャのように操作し、「コピーまたは保存時にCR/LFを保持にチェックを入れOKボタンを押します。~ クエリ結果 -> SQL Server -> 結果をグリッドに表示 #br #ref(02.png) #br 尚、設定しても改行保持でコピーできなかった場合は、SSMSを再起動してください。 以上の操作により、クエリー結果をコピーしても改行が保持されてクリップボードに保存されます。~
テキスト整形のルールを表示する
添付ファイル:
02.png
218件
[
詳細
]
01.png
150件
[
詳細
]